The baby name Aldtun is a boy name, 2 syllables long and is pronounced "ahl-dun".
Aldtun is English in Origin.
Aldtun is a name of English origin, which means "old town". The name is composed of two elements: "ald", meaning old, and "tun", meaning town. The name Aldtun has been in use since the Middle Ages, and was likely given to individuals who lived in or near an old town.
The gender of the name Aldtun is masculine. It is not a very common name, and is not currently ranked in the top 1000 names in the United States. The pronunciation of Aldtun is "ALD-tun", with the emphasis on the first syllable.
